Step-by-Step Guide

The first step in creating a mesh wreath is gathering the necessary materials. You will need a wreath form, mesh ribbon (also known as deco mesh), pipe cleaners, wire cutters, and various decorations such as ribbons, flowers, or ornaments.

To create the base of the wreath, cut the mesh ribbon into 10-12 inch pieces with wire cutters. Attach each piece to the wreath form with a pipe cleaner, using a twisting motion to secure the mesh. Continue to attach the mesh pieces to the form until the entire wreath form is covered.

Next, add your desired decorations to the wreath. This can include ribbons, flowers, ornaments, or other embellishments. Arrange the decorations as desired, securing them to the wreath form with pipe cleaners. Be creative and experiment with different colours, textures, and shapes to make your wreath unique.

Finally, add the finishing touches to the wreath. This includes fluffing the mesh and creating a bow to attach to the wreath. Use wire cutters to trim any excess pipe cleaners or mesh pieces.

Seasonal Themes

Mesh wreaths are perfect for seasonal décor! Here are some ideas for creating wreaths for different holidays and occasions:

Christmas

For a Christmas wreath, use festive colours such as red, green, and gold. Add decorations such as pinecones, ornaments, and a large bow. You can also incorporate lights into your wreath for a glowing effect.

Easter

For an Easter wreath, use pastel colours such as lavender, pink, and yellow. Add decorations such as Easter eggs, flowers, and a bunny figure. You can also incorporate a seasonal phrase, such as “Happy Easter” or “Spring has Sprung.”

Halloween

For a Halloween wreath, use spooky colours such as black, orange, and purple. Add decorations such as bats, spiders, and cobwebs. You can also incorporate a seasonal phrase, such as “Trick or Treat” or “Boo!”

Tips and Tricks

Here are some of our favourite tips and tricks for making a stunning mesh wreath:

– Choose the right mesh: Make sure to select mesh that is of high quality and sturdy enough to hold its shape.

– Be colour-conscious: Consider the colour scheme of the room or area where the wreath will be displayed. Choose colours that complement the overall décor.

– Create interesting shapes: Experiment with different shapes, such as a heart or a letter for a personalized touch.

– Add embellishments: Use decorations that complement the overall look of the wreath. For example, if you have a floral wreath, add small flowers for a cohesive look.

Beginner’s Guide

If you are new to making mesh wreaths, here are some tips to get you started:

– Basic materials: All you really need for a simple wreath is a base form, mesh ribbon, and pipe cleaners.

– Choosing a wreath form: You can use many different materials for the form, such as a wire frame or even a pool noodle!

– Starting simple: Begin with a basic wreath using simple colours and no embellishments. Once you have the basic technique down, you can move on to more complicated wreaths.
